Dreamweaver is so good, you really wouldn't even need to know HTML to use it. But I'm just kind of saying that ...

We used Dreamweaver for my 2nd Quarter in my Web Design class last year, it's insanely easy to use. It does the code for you, that's basically what that and Frontpage do. Sometimes, and especially with tables, it can mess up though.

Basically you just create and tweak want you want on one page, and it generates the code on another, which of course you can alter if it's messed up.

Dreamweavers also good because you can easily make Flash buttons with it, generate Templates and CSS (but CSS is really easy in the first place), and a lot more.

True: If you're having an easy time with HTML manually, Dreamweaver / Frontpage, or whatever program you may use for that, will be incredibly easy for you.
